In many cities the existing drainage system is not designed for the increase of prolonged and severe rain showers resulting in flooding of streets. With the Hydrorock solution excess water is buffered quickly and easily under the existing infrastructure and infiltrated into the soil. Thus the chance of inconvenience is reduced strongly and it contributes to the improvement of the soil and the groundwater level. Simple solution for existing infrastructure The Municipality of Amersfoort experienced much inconvenience from puddles in a parking area in the city centre of Amersfoort. In times of heavy rains the capacity of the drainage system is insufficient and subsequently the parking area becomes flooded. With the installation of Hydrorock buffers the excess water will be absorbed quickly from now on. The infiltration blocks which can buffer 95% of their volume of water, then gradually release the water to the soil. Now there are no more puddles on the parking lot. The system may be used in existing situations effectively, as the groundwork remains limited in comparison with alternative solutions.
